How much do associate cloud engineer jobs pay per year?

As of Aug 25, 2026, the average yearly pay for associate cloud engineer in Idaho is $77,752.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$61,600.00 and $89,400.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What does an Associate Cloud Engineer do?

An Associate Cloud Engineer is responsible for deploying, managing, and maintaining cloud-based solutions. They work with cloud platforms like Google Cloud, AWS, or Azure to configure infrastructure, monitor system performance, and ensure security compliance. They also assist in automation, troubleshooting, and optimizing cloud resources to improve efficiency. This role requires knowledge of cloud computing principles, networking, and scripting languages.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an Associate Cloud Engineer?

To thrive as an Associate Cloud Engineer, you need a solid grasp of cloud computing fundamentals, programming/scripting skills (such as Python or Bash), and experience with deploying and managing cloud services, typically supported by a relevant degree or certification. Familiarity with major cloud platforms like Google Cloud Platform, AWS, or Azure, and certifications such as the Google Associate Cloud Engineer or AWS Certified Solutions Architect, are highly valued. Strong problem-solving, communication, and teamwork abilities allow you to effectively address technical issues and collaborate with cross-functional teams. These skills and qualities are essential for ensuring reliable cloud operations, optimizing performance, and supporting the organization's technology goals.

Job description

About Your Role
Data Airflow engineers the flow of data and air through complex infrastructure. The Microsoft Cloud Administrator owns and operates our all-cloud Microsoft environment, including cloud identity, security, and Microsoft 365. This role manages cloud identity, secures our cloud and endpoints, and keeps Microsoft 365 running reliably for every team, partnering with the Director of IT on roadmap and risk.
What You'll Do (Job Responsibilities)
  • Administer the full Microsoft cloud stack across the environment.
  • Manage cloud identity, including users, groups, devices, and conditional access.
  • Own Microsoft 365 administration, including Exchange Online, SharePoint, OneDrive, and Power Platform apps.
  • Leverage PowerShell and Power Automate to script automations and streamline operations.
  • Lead security operations across the environment, including Microsoft Defender, Intune endpoint management, multifactor authentication, and data loss prevention.
  • Monitor, investigate, and respond to support and access requests.
  • Centrally deploy patches, baselines, and compliance policies to keep systems current and audit-ready.
  • Document configurations, procedures, and changes for consistency and handoff.
  • Provide escalated support to teams and partner with the Director of IT on roadmap and risk.
  • Other duties as assigned.

Required Qualifications:
  • Five or more years administering Microsoft cloud environments.
  • Hands-on expertise with Microsoft Entra ID and Microsoft 365.
  • Proven experience securing identity, endpoints, and cloud services.
  • Working knowledge of Intune, Microsoft Defender, and conditional access.

  • Strong PowerShell scripting for automation and reporting.
  • Clear written and verbal communication.

Preferred Qualifications:
  • Microsoft certifications, including one or more of the following:
  • SC-300 Microsoft Identity and Access Administrator (Entra ID, conditional access, identity governance).
  • MS-102 Microsoft 365 Administrator (tenant-wide Microsoft 365 management).
  • AZ-104 Azure Administrator Associate (core Azure cloud administration).
  • SC-500 Cloud and AI Security Engineer Associate (cloud and AI security operations; replaces the retiring AZ-500, which remains acceptable during transition).
  • SC-900 Security, Compliance, and Identity Fundamentals (foundational credential).
  • Experience in a regulated or engineering-driven environment.
  • Familiarity with Zero Trust architecture and security frameworks.
